[30th anniversary of the march on Washington choir concert]

Video footage from The Black Academy of Arts and Letters recorded during rehearsals for the 30th anniversary of the march on Washington celebratory performance held at the Kennedy performing arts center in Washington D. C.. Entitled "I Remember.." the show includes speakers, dancers, musicians, a large choir, and gospel singer Lalah Hathaway.

[Akin Babatunde as Louis Armstrong broadcast clip]

Video footage provided by The Black Academy of Arts and Letters of a Channel 8 broadcast clip showing a news story on the upcoming performance of Akin Babatunde at the Clarence Muse Café Theatre in November of 1997. The footage shows clips of the actor impersonating music icon Louis Armstrong with the song "What a Wonderful World" along with an interview on his process of successfully becoming the character.

[Black Music and the Civil Rights Movement 1991 concert, tape #4]

Video footage from The Black Academy of Arts and Letters recorded during the eighth annual Black Music and the Civil Rights Movement Concert in 1991. The concert featured Cissy Houston and choir and was held at the Meyerson Symphony Center in Dallas Texas. The videotape shows Cissy Houston wearing a pink formal dress singing in front of a drum set, piano, and a large gospel choir. The choir wears red and black choir robes and stands on a curved set of bleachers. At the eight-minute mark, a man comes on stage to speak. The video covers four songs of the concert

["Black Music and the Civil Rights Movement Concert" held in Washington, D. C. spot commercial]

Video footage provided by The Black Academy of Arts and Letters of a short spot clip recorded for the annual "Black Music and the Civil Rights Concert" to be held at Howard University on March 4th, 1995. The footage shows clips of the featured singers including Billy Preston, Jennifer Holiday, and Lola Falana with a voice narration explaining the venue and how to purchase tickets.
